Economic Recovery & Expansion Strategy. The Economic Recovery and Expansion Strategy (ERES) is the framework for long-term economic development success, created as part of New Hampshire’s plan to recover from the Covid-19 pandemic. New Hampshire Exports Set New Record, Top $5.8 Billion

For the third straight year, New Hampshire exports set a new record, topping $5.8 billion in 2019, up 10 percent from 2018, according to federal trade data. “The latest export numbers show that New Hampshire has entered the global arena as a hub for advanced manufacturing,” said Gov.
